African Youngsters Make Waves in Dubai Music Scene with Hip-hop
DUBAI — More people are taking to the hip-hop culture in a serious way after the local brothers — Illmiyah (Salim Dahman) and Arableak (Abdallah Dahman) — made the music popular here.
The future of hip-hop in Dubai is continuously having surprises, the most recent being three African expat security guards who joined the fraternity here.
The threesome from two east African countries — Tanzania and Uganda — have already composed a number of singles that are already filling up most of the African Dubai based nightclubs and have had some of their songs played on the local FM stations.
